Transaction 32d606769a0ceeea2c83557ebd3afcc44afb555d523eb03c08d120db57d23dca
1 Input
2 Outputs
- 32d606769a0ceeea2c83557ebd3afcc44afb555d523eb03c08d120db57d23dca:0
- 32d606769a0ceeea2c83557ebd3afcc44afb555d523eb03c08d120db57d23dca:1
value 2811903398
address 1FhscD2i8ZkT95gDh2EFdumn3ERoMfQj2t
value 434476602
address 17chMJB5HKrL2gLxmRszKXkox8jNBDCjir